At Bread and Life we typically register 40-to-50 new guests per month, we are now registering 40-to-50 per day. The need has grown so quickly that most emergency food providers like us are scrambling to meet the increasing need. Each day the line grows longer and longer, and those waiting show up earlier and earlier. Our staff do their very best to ensure that everyone on the line is served with the same dignity and compassion that are the hallmarks of Bread and Life.
